Historical Context: From Classic Reels to Interactive Experiences

Traditional slot machines, with their simple three-reel setups and limited pay lines, prioritized mechanical reliability. The transition to digital platforms revolutionized this paradigm, allowing for intricate graphics, themed narratives, and a variety of bonus mechanisms. Early online slots introduced basic features such as wild symbols and free spins, but modern titles now incorporate complex layers of interactivity that captivate and retain players.

Key Innovations Shaping Modern Slot Game Features

1. Cascading Reels and Cluster Pays

These features break away from traditional paylines. Instead, symbols clear in sequences (cascades) or clusters to trigger rewards, creating dynamic, chain reaction-style play. This approach not only increases engagement but also boosts the frequency of wins, encouraging longer play sessions.

2. Expanding and Sticky Wilds

Wild symbols that expand to cover entire reels or remain (“stick”) on the screen for multiple spins have become integral. They significantly enhance win potential while adding satisfying visual feedback, and are often tied to bonus features or special game modes.

3. Multi-Level Bonus Rounds

Modern slots feature elaborate bonus games—sometimes with multi-layered structures—that simulate skill-based or narrative-driven experiences, elevating the entertainment value beyond simple luck-based outcomes.

Data-Driven Design: The Role of Player Feedback

Sophisticated game developers increasingly rely on big data analytics to refine features. Understanding which mechanisms—such as particular bonus triggers or wild configurations—most effectively retain players or increase their bet sizes, informs the ongoing innovation of slot game features. For example, recent studies have shown that interactive bonus rounds boost session durations by up to 35%, highlighting the importance of engaging mechanics.

Future Outlook: Towards Personalization and Augmented Reality

Emerging trends suggest that personalization—adapting game mechanics to individual player preferences—and augmented reality (AR) integrations will define the next phase of slot features. Imagine slots that adapt themes, volatility levels, or bonus triggers based on AI-driven insights, or AR-enhanced experiences that convert the traditional spinning reel into a fully immersive adventure. Such advances could redefine player engagement metrics and revenue models.
